Portfolio

No investments yet. Here is the map instead.

Fund I has not closed, so there is no portfolio to show and we will not dress one up. Publishing the constraint map is the more useful disclosure — it is what we should be judged against later.

The map

Seven families we underwrite.

Each is a place where the field repeatedly fails in the same way. Leverage — whether one solution can serve many systems — is the whole argument, so we rate it explicitly rather than implying it.

01

Robot data engines

Collection, curation and feedback loops that turn operating hours into training signal. Data is the scarcest input in the field and the hardest to buy.

High leverage Data & simulation
02

Simulation & sim-to-real

Scenario generation, domain randomisation and transfer measurement. The gap between simulated and real performance is still paid for in hardware and time.

High leverage Data & simulation
03

Evaluation, safety & observability

Benchmarks, regression harnesses, incident analysis and runtime monitoring. Capability is advancing faster than the ability to say whether it works.

High leverage Evaluation
04

Edge inference & orchestration

Running competent models on the robot within latency, power and reliability budgets, and coordinating them across a machine.

Medium leverage Runtime
05

Manipulation primitives

Reusable grasping, force control and contact-rich skills that transfer between platforms rather than being rebuilt per robot.

High leverage Runtime
06

Fleet & intervention infrastructure

Deployment, teleoperation, escalation and utilisation tooling. The layer that turns a successful pilot into an operation.

Medium leverage Runtime
07

Selective enabling hardware

Tactile sensing, force control and actuation where the physics genuinely gates the software layer. Selective, because most hardware is not a constraint.

Situational Hardware
Limits

The concentration rules we intend to hold ourselves to.

A constraint fund fails by drifting: into adjacent categories, into one vertical, or into a single platform's ecosystem. These are the limits that keep the construction honest.

  • Single company, of committed capital Max 10%
  • Single constraint family Max 30%
  • Single end vertical Max 35%
  • Dependent on one platform vendor Max 25%
  • Selective enabling hardware Max 20%
  • Reserved for follow-on ~45%
